Abstract

Objective: To assess left ventricular function, including global longitudinal strain measured by two-dimensional speckle tracking echocardiography, before and after percutaneous coronary intervention in patients with ST-segment elevation myocardial infarction presenting late after 48 hours.

Methods: A prospective longitudinal study with a before-after design was conducted in 40 patients with late-presenting ST-segment elevation myocardial infarction at Vietnam National Heart Institute. All patients underwent percutaneous coronary intervention. Left ventricular ejection fraction and average global longitudinal strain (GLS Avg) were measured before intervention and at 30 days. Multivariable linear regression was used to identify independent predictors of longitudinal strain recovery.

Results: Compared with baseline, mean left ventricular ejection fraction improved from 49.44 ± 10.26% to 53.28 ± 11.35%, and GLS Avg improved from -11.86 ± 4.61% to -13.37 ± 3.91%. In multivariable analysis, only baseline GLS Avg (B = -2.8; p = 0.009) and a left anterior descending artery culprit lesion (B = -2.37; p = 0.024) were independent predictors of longitudinal strain recovery.

Conclusion: Percutaneous coronary intervention in patients with late-presenting acute myocardial infarction produced a marked improvement in systolic function and left ventricular longitudinal strain at 30 days. Baseline left ventricular global longitudinal strain and an left anterior descending culprit lesion were independent predictors of the magnitude of longitudinal strain recovery, outperforming traditional indices such as baseline left ventricular ejection fraction or NT-proBNP.
